COMMAND LINE INTERFACE

This switch supports ACLs for ingress filtering only. You can only bind one IP ACL to any port and one MAC ACL globally for ingress filtering. In other words, only two ACLs can be bound to an interface - Ingress IP ACL and Ingress MAC ACL.

The order in which active ACLs are checked is as follows:

1.User-defined rules in the Ingress MAC ACL for ingress ports.

2.User-defined rules in the Ingress IP ACL for ingress ports.

3.Explicit default rule (permit any any) in the ingress IP ACL for ingress ports.

4.Explicit default rule (permit any any) in the ingress MAC ACL for ingress ports.

5.If no explicit rule is matched, the implicit default is permit all.

The SMC Networks SMC6752AL2 is a robust and versatile gigabit Ethernet switch designed to cater to the demands of medium to large enterprise networks. This switch delivers an impressive combination of performance, flexibility, and manageability, making it an ideal solution for businesses seeking to enhance their network infrastructure.

One of the standout features of the SMC6752AL2 is its 48 Gigabit Ethernet ports, allowing for high-speed network connections to a variety of devices such as servers, workstations, and other networked equipment. Additionally, the switch includes 4 SFP (Small Form-factor Pluggable) slots that provide options for connecting to other networking devices via fiber optics, enhancing the versatility of the network configuration.

The SMC6752AL2 supports advanced Layer 2 switching capabilities, which are crucial for efficient data handling and traffic management. With features such as VLAN (Virtual Local Area Network) support, the switch can segment network traffic to improve performance and security while effectively managing broadcast domains. It supports 802.1Q VLAN tagging, allowing for better network segmentation and isolation of different types of traffic.

Moreover, the switch is equipped with Quality of Service (QoS) features to prioritize critical data transmissions. This is essential for applications requiring real-time data flow, such as VoIP (Voice over Internet Protocol) and video conferencing. The SMC6752AL2's QoS capabilities enable users to classify and prioritize traffic, ensuring a smooth and seamless experience for bandwidth-intensive applications.

The SMC6752AL2 also includes features such as port mirroring and link aggregation, enhancing the monitoring and management capabilities of the network. Port mirroring allows administrators to duplicate traffic from one port to another for analysis and troubleshooting, while link aggregation enables combining multiple connections for increased bandwidth and redundancy.

In terms of security, the switch supports802.1X port-based authentication, providing a layer of network access control that ensures only authorized users can connect. This feature, combined with the ability to create access control lists (ACLs), helps to safeguard the network against unauthorized access and other potential threats.
